Angel Fire State Veteran Cemetery
31 Onate Rd. (County Rd. B4), Angel Fire, NM, 87710
GPS Coordinates:
36.439021, -105.295371
County: Colfax
Record count: 84
Ownership: New Mexico Department of Veterans Services
Directions: Located north of Angel Fire, along the north side of US-64, on the north end of the runway of Angel Fire Airport.
Background: Angel Fire State Veterans Cemetery originated from Governor Susana Martinez's 2013 State Rural Veterans Cemetery initiative. The David Westphall Veterans Foundation Board and Village of Angel Fire requested Angel Fire as a cemetery location, with Harry Patterson and his wife Brenda donating 10 acres adjacent to the Vietnam Veterans Memorial.
On April 15, 2014, Governor Martinez announced Angel Fire's selection as one of four proposed sites after fierce statewide competition. In September 2018, Governor Martinez announced full funding was secured, with the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s providing a $3.2 million grant. Construction began in May 2019, and the first interment occurred on July 27, 2020, for Darrel Fugett, who had volunteered at the adjacent Vietnam Veterans Memorial.
